Taxpayers can withdraw court cases and approach GST Tribunal for speedier outcomes

Taxpayers can withdraw their GST-related cases filed in High Courts and the Supreme Court and lodge them with the upcoming GST appellate tribunals so as to speed up their outcomes,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man said in the Lok Sabha on Tuesday. The Parliament’s Lower House subsequently passed amendments to the central GST law aimed at operationalising the tribunals at the earliest.

BIG NEWS: Taxpayers may be allowed to file revised GST returns from April 2025

The government is considering allowing filing of updated or revised returns under the goods and services tax (GST), a move expected to benefit taxpayers and also bring down litigation under the indirect tax regime. As per the proposal, taxpayers will be able to rectify their returns including computation of tax, ET has learnt. “We are looking at allowing updated returns under GST,” a senior official told ET.

GST Amnesty scheme appeals applicable till January 31, 2024: Check eligibility

In a bid to assist taxpayers grappling with Goods and Services Tax (GST) issues, the Central Board of Indirect Taxes and Customs (CBIC) has introduced a significant amnesty scheme. This initiative allows specified GST taxpayers to lodge appeals against GST tax demand orders until January 31, 2024.

West Bengal government keeps e-way bill order in abeyance, intrastate limit back to Rs 1 lakh

The West Bengal government has kept in abeyance the order that reduced the “intrastate e-way bill” threshold from Rs 1 lakh to Rs 50,000, effective from December 1, a top official said on Thursday.
